Comments from the newest, biggest, hawk at the Fed:
- She dissented at the last two meetings on concerns about financial stability and inflation
- Extended period encourages risk taking that could prove to be unhealthy
- Concerned that thresholds could allow tolerance for inflation above 2%
- Her goal is not premature withdrawal of policy support but seeing transition from crisis policy response
- Trying to speed up the recovery creates risks in the longer term
